The Importance of Linear Guides in Mechanical Engineering

Linear guides are essential components in mechanical engineering, enabling precise movement and positioning of machine parts. They are used in CNC machines, automation technology, and many other areas where exact motion sequences are required. Their design ensures high stability and low friction, leading to improved efficiency and a longer service life for the machines.

What to Look for When Buying Linear Guides

When purchasing linear guides, several factors should be considered to find the right solution for your specific requirements. First, load capacity is crucial, as it must account for the weight and dynamics of the moving parts. Accuracy also plays a central role: the more precise the linear guide, the better the quality of the manufactured parts. Ease of installation and maintenance should also be taken into account, as this can significantly impact operating costs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are linear guides suitable for?
Linear guides are suitable for the precise movement and positioning of components in various machines and systems, particularly in CNC machines and automation technology.
Which materials are used for linear guides?
High-quality materials such as steel, aluminium or special plastics are frequently used for linear guides, offering high stability and low friction.
How do linear guides affect the accuracy of a machine?
A high-quality linear guide ensures exact motion sequences and minimises play, leading to improved accuracy and quality of the manufactured parts.
What must be considered when mounting linear guides?
When mounting linear guides, attention should be paid to clean and precise alignment to ensure optimal functionality and longevity.
How often should linear guides be maintained?
The maintenance of linear guides depends on usage and operating conditions. However, it is advisable to carry out regular inspections and clean and lubricate the guides as needed.
